The Executive Development Programme in Child Rights and Public Health offers a variety of rewarding career paths. Here are some of the top roles in the industry, represented in a 3D pie chart to show their demand and relevance in the job market:
1. **Child Rights Policy Analyst**: This role involves analyzing and evaluating policies, laws, and regulations related to child rights, and proposing recommendations for improvement. With a salary range of £30,000 to £50,000, it's a challenging and rewarding career path for those interested in child welfare and advocacy.
2. **Public Health Project Manager**: This role involves managing public health projects, such as vaccination campaigns, disease surveillance, and health promotion initiatives. With a salary range of £35,000 to £60,000, it's a dynamic and impactful career path for those interested in improving community health outcomes.
3. **Child Rights Programme Coordinator**: This role involves coordinating and managing child rights programs, such as education, healthcare, and protection initiatives. With a salary range of £30,000 to £50,000, it's a fulfilling and meaningful career path for those passionate about children's rights and wellbeing.
4. **Public Health Data Analyst**: This role involves analyzing and interpreting public health data, such as disease prevalence, health behaviors, and demographic trends. With a salary range of £25,000 to £45,000, it's a growing and in-demand career path for those interested in data analytics and health research.
5. **Child Rights Advocate**: This role involves advocating for children's rights and welfare, such as lobbying policymakers, engaging with communities, and raising awareness of child rights issues. With a salary range of £25,000 to £45,000, it's a rewarding and impactful career path for those passionate about social justice and children's rights.
6. **Public Health Consultant**: This role involves providing expert advice and guidance on public health issues, such as disease prevention, health promotion, and policy development. With a salary range of £40,000 to £80,000, it's a senior and prestigious career path for those with extensive experience and expertise in public health.
